On this deeply personal tour, we will visit the lesser-known streets, shops and buildings which played a huge role in Churchill’s life and self-image. You’ll check out the shop where he purchased his iconic cigars, stand in the military parade ground with its own hidden WW2 communications centre, visit the wine merchant with cellars running beneath the street, and take in the social clubs of which he was a member.
Hear about his relationships to his wife Clementine and President Roosevelt, his life as a young soldier, and the stories of valour and predestiny which shaped his journey to become the man of the hour.
And then for the mind blowing trip into the Churchill War Rooms. Here you’ll be able to self-guide through London’s most atmospheric and haunting museum, literally entering a time capsule from London in the War. Please note your guide will not enter the museum.
